1986 THE NEW ZEALAND GAZETTE. [No. 91]
Rainfall for October—continued.
Station. Observer. Total Fall, in Inches. Days of Rain. Maximum Fall, and Date (for previous Twenty-four Hours).
SOUTH ISLAND.
(A.) North Aspect—Cape Campbell to Kaikoura.
Nelson .. .. .. Dr. Hudson .. .. 1·71 7 0·63 on 24th.
Stephens Island*.. .. .. .. Lightkeeper .. .. 1·45 7 0·55 on 24th.
The Brothers† .. .. .. Lightkeeper .. .. 1·30 3 0·70 on 24th.
Blenheim .. .. .. N. Prichard .. .. 1·07 6 0·88 on 24th.
Cape Campbell .. .. .. Lightkeeper .. .. 0·55 1 0·55 on 24th.
Flaxbourne .. .. .. W. Tatchell .. .. 1·06 4 0·58 on 24th.
Kekerangu .. .. .. W. J. White .. .. 0·95 5 0·66 on 24th.
Kaikoura .. .. .. Miss G. Collins .. .. 1·41 6 0·63 on 6th.
(B.) West Aspect—Cape Farewell to Puysegur Point.
Farewell Spit .. .. .. Lightkeeper .. .. 1·43 12 0·37 on 16th.
Pakawau .. .. .. T. C. V. Field .. .. 6·42 24 1·05 on 17th.
Westport .. .. .. H. S. Ewan .. .. 7·22 20 0·93 on 29th.
Ngahere .. .. .. J. Scott .. .. 10·76 19 1·40 on 19th.
Greymouth .. .. .. J. Conner .. .. 11·15 19 2·23 on 20th.
Hokitika .. .. .. A. D. Macfarlane .. .. 12·99 20 2·39 on 19th.
Bealey .. .. .. C. White .. .. 4·73 9 1·00 on 17th & 20th.
Dusky Sound .. .. .. R. Henry .. .. .. .. ..
(C.) East Aspect—Kaikoura to Cape Saunders.
Waiau .. .. .. J. A. Northcote .. .. 1·58 6 0·63 on 24th.
Akaroa .. .. .. Miss Jacobson .. .. 2·40 8 0·48 on 24th.
Port Hills (Christchurch) .. .. .. Miss M. L. Higgins .. .. 1·45 9 0·42 on 24th.
Christchurch .. .. .. A. L. Taylor .. .. 1·65 9 0·63 on 23rd.
Linwood .. .. .. J. A. Biltcliff .. .. 1·50 10 0·63 on 24th.
Lincoln .. .. .. C. O. Lillie .. .. 1·57 12 0·52 on 24th.
Southbridge .. .. .. J. McMillan .. .. 1·17 10 0·49 on 24th.
Hororata .. .. .. Hon. Sir J. Hall, K.C.M.G. .. .. 1·57 8 0·68 on 24th.
Kapunatiki .. .. .. Hon. W. Rolleston .. .. .. .. ..
Mt. Peel .. .. .. Miss L. A. D. Acland .. .. 2·63 11 1·08 on 24th.
Peel Forest .. .. .. W. E. Barker .. .. 3·01 6 1·46 on 24th.
Methven .. .. .. H. G. Baker .. .. 2·16 5 1·13 on 24th.
Drayton (Methven) .. .. .. E. Chapman .. .. 2·18 6 1·17 on 24th.
Ashburton .. .. .. A. E. Hart .. .. 2·07 5 0·81 on 24th.
Fairlie .. .. .. D. H. Gillingham .. .. 1·40 11 0·77 on 24th.
Geraldine .. .. .. Captain E. F. Temple, J.P. .. .. 2·99 6 1·80 on 24th.
Oamaru .. .. .. E. Menlove .. .. 1·98 11 0·90 on 23rd.
Makeno† .. .. .. R. A. Chaffey .. .. 1·53 6 0·35 on 24th.
(D.) South Aspect—Cape Saunders to Puysegur Point.
Maketown .. .. .. W. J. Stanford .. .. 4·56 9 1·30 on 21st.
Queenstown .. .. .. L. Hotop .. .. 3·55 11 0·75 on 20th.
St. Bathan's .. .. .. J. Ewing .. .. 3·85 14 0·81 on 20th.
Middlemarch .. .. .. D. Crawford .. .. 1·11 4 0·67 on 21st.
Gladbrook Station .. .. .. D. Crawford .. .. 1·74 12 0·50 on 21st.
Kokonga .. .. .. R. W. Glendinning .. .. 1·22 9 0·53 on 24th.
Dunedin .. .. .. Government Observer .. .. 4·74 19 1·08 on 30th.
Kaitangata .. .. .. W. M. Shore .. .. 3·44 19 0·73 on 4th.
Balclutha .. .. .. C. C. Halliday .. .. 3·15 13 0·75 on 30th.
Naseby .. .. .. G. L. Stewart .. .. 1·47 9 0·45 on 24th.
Clyde .. .. .. L. D. Macgeorge .. .. 1·16 7 0·43 on 20th.
Wyndham .. .. .. W. H. Rodney .. .. 7·19 14 1·15 on 30th.
Dipton .. .. .. R. D. MacLachlan .. .. 4·62 15 1·38 on 20th.
Ratanui .. .. .. G. M. Draper .. .. 6·36 21 1·57 on 21st.
Invercargill .. .. .. J. L. Bush .. .. 5·59 24 0·95 on 16th.
Otautau .. .. .. N. A. McLaren .. .. 8·32 19 1·35 on 30th.
Nightcaps .. .. .. J. Ritchie .. .. 4·83 21 1·35 on 20th.
Puysegur Point§ .. .. .. Lightkeeper .. .. 29·58 27 5·38 on 14th.
